WhiteHorse Finance (NASDAQ:WHF) CEO Buys $96,880.00 in Stock

WhiteHorse Finance, Inc. (NASDAQ:WHFGet Free Report) CEO Stuart Aronson acquired 14,000 shares of the stock in a transaction on Wednesday, November 12th. The shares were acquired at an average price of $6.92 per share, with a total value of $96,880.00.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er directly owned 50,000 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$346,000. The trade was a 38.89% increase in their ownership of the stock. The purchase was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through the SEC website.

WhiteHorse Finance Cuts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, January 5th. Stockholders of record on Monday, December 22nd will be given a dividend of $0.25 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, December 22nd. This represents a $1.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 14.2%. WhiteHorse Finance’s payout ratio is currently 232.56%.

About WhiteHorse Finance

(Get Free Report)

WhiteHorse Finance, Inc is business development company, non-diversified, closed end management company specializing in originating senior secured loans, lower middle market, growth capital industries. It invests in broadline retail, office services and supplies, building products, health care services, health care supplies, research and consulting services, application software, home furnishings, specialized consumer services, data processing and outsourced services, leisure facilities, cable, and satellite.
